PHOTO: REUTERS ISLAMABAD: During the rule of Prime Minister Imran Khan, the Pakistan Railways (PR) has suffered a loss of over Rs1.19 trillion – compelling it to discontinue trains on 36 routes. In view of the crisis, the PR has also decided to outsource 15 trains to private companies, the National Assembly was told. Minister of States for Parliamentary Affairs Ali Muhammad Khan on Friday presented to the house a report, containing details with regard to losses incurred by the country’s biggest employer and the money that various government and private sector organizations owe to the PR.
